😐A single person spends $1,133 per month in Tobago vs $861 in Chiang Mai, rent included.
😐A couple spends around $1,881 per month in Tobago vs $1,350 in Chiang Mai, rent included.
😐A family of three spends $2,630 per month in Tobago vs $1,838 in Chiang Mai, rent included.
😐Tobago costs about 32% more than Chiang Mai,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.
📊Both Tobago and Chiang Mai are more affordable than the global median – Tobago15% lower, Chiang Mai36% lower.

Cost Breakdown
🏠A central one-bedroom costs $403 in Tobago versus $432 in Chiang Mai.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.
💰Salaries run about 27% higher in Tobago, which partly offsets the higher cost of living there. Purchasing power depends on which expenses matter most to you.
🛒A mid-range dinner for two costs $66.0 in Tobago versus $18.00 in Chiang Mai.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$329 vs $243 – making Chiang Mai the more affordable choice for daily food spending.

Tobago vs Chiang Mai: Cost of Living - Frequently Asked Questions
Which city is more expensive, Tobago or Chiang Mai?
Tobago costs about 32% more than Chiang Mai, with the gap driven mainly by Groceries & Markets. That's enough to noticeably affect everyday spending and lifestyle for anyone choosing between the two.
How much do you need to earn to live comfortably in Tobago and in Chiang Mai?
For a comfortable life, plan on about $1,699 per month in Tobago and $1,292 in Chiang Mai. That covers rent, food, utilities, transport, and enough left over to feel settled – not just surviving.
Where is rent cheaper, Tobago or Chiang Mai?
Rent is clearly cheaper in Chiang Mai, especially for central apartments. Housing is actually the single biggest factor behind the overall cost gap between these two cities.
How do dining costs compare in Tobago and in Chiang Mai?
A mid-range dinner for two costs $66.0 in Tobago and $18.00 in Chiang Mai. That's a good indicator of the overall restaurant and café pricing gap between the two cities.
Are groceries more expensive in Tobago or in Chiang Mai?
Groceries cost about 35% more in Tobago, though it depends on what you buy. Local produce may be comparable; imported and premium items show the biggest price gap.
Can you live on $1,000/month in Tobago or in Chiang Mai?
A $1,000 monthly budget goes further in Chiang Mai, where all-in costs run around $861, than in Tobago at $1,133. In Chiang Mai it covers expenses comfortably, while in Tobago it requires careful planning or may not stretch far enough.
